My Lyman & Speer manuals say you can go up to 4.2 gr
of Bullseye with a 158 gr bullet. This should get you
to 880 fps. If your gun is rated for +P, this should
present no risk, but I would look out for split cases,
and back off if you find more than the very rare
instance.
I don't shoot 38 SPL in IDPA, but I remember Chris
talking about how hard it is to get 38 up to power
factor.
